Urban Decay Smoked Eyeshadow Palette - Review, Photos and Swatches

Urban Decay Smoked Eyeshadow Palette - Review, Photos and Swatches


 
 

After the Naked and Naked 2 palettes, now they have the Smoked Palette!
 
With a combination of some permanent and some new and exclusive eyeshadows, the newest palette from UD includes:
 
 
- Kinky (pale, neutral peach - matte finish) New and exclusive!
 
- Freestyle (light peach - matte finish) New and exclusive!
 
- Mushroom (frosty grey-brown - shimmery finish) Permanent
 
- Back Door (dark brown with a hint of gray - matte finish) New and exclusive!
 
- Blackout (deep black - matte finish) Permanent
 
- Barlust (rich bronze - shimmery finish) New and exclusive!
 
- Rockstar (deep purple - shimmery finish) Permanent
 
- Evidence (deep navy blue - shimmery finish) Permanent
 
- Loaded (deep green-teal - shimmery finish) Permanent
 
- Asphalt (deep gunmetal - shimmery finish) New and exclusive!
 
- Eyeliner in Perversion (black) Permanent
 
- Mini Primer Potion (Original) Permanent

- Book with tutorials Permanent

EYESHADOW: 10 x 0.8g e 10 x 0.03 US oz
EYE PENCIL: 1.2g e 0.04 US oz
PRIMER POTION: 3.7ml e 0.13 US fl oz

This palette opens with a zipp and inside there is a mirror, ten eyeshadows and a full-size eyeliner. Perversion is a TRUE black (darker than Zero) and very creamy and easy to apply.
 
It also comes with a mini Primer Potion (in Original) that make your eyeshadows really more vibrant and a book with tutorials.

The eyeshadows range is very good and the new formula is awesome! They are very creamy, pigmented and easily blendable.
 
Maybe the only two that were slightly powdery were Kinky and Freestyle and the one that had a little less color payoff was Evidence so it needed a little more work.

Whether you’re a beginner or a professional, this kit is perfect for you! You can do lots of looks with it if you like to play with color, or even some a little more neutral. This palette is a good option and worth the price!
